Singer Dawn Zee and songwriter Neil Reid co-founded Jersey Street in 1997, following a period when Reid had recorded for Robs Records as a solo artist. Rounding out the group are Stephen Chesney, who is the band's mix master and engineer, and Matt Steele, who plays keyboard. Junior Boys Own put out Nobody But My Lord, the group's first record, and it hit the airwaves in 1998. The label Glasgow Underground soon signed the band.
